Mountain Rescue Recruit Orientation
Mountain Rescue is looking for experienced back-country hikers, climbers and backpackers to join our Team. The Recruit Orientation on Saturday, March 5th will provide a comprehensive overview of the Team, the Selection Process and criteria and information on how you can give back to your community....

Wilderness First Aid Class - Jan 29/30
HAZ, Central Arizona Mountain Rescue Association will be conducting a 2-day Wilderness First Aid Certification course on January 29 & 30 (Saturday / Sunday), 2011. This two day/16 hour course provides classroom and hands-on instruction on how to prevent and respond to medical situations while in...

Remember, there are more many clues and only one GPSJoe. Look for clues such as a debris field (hat, pack, hiking poles, glasses) in areas where a fall may have been possible.
